This is a very interesting picture here! I like the angle you went for with the background, I don't really see that approach done often.

The zubats everywhere really makes it feel like everything's floating; which is why the gengar and the mimikyu are kinda' jarring. I'd say they should probably probably be in the foreground, to make it feel more like they're breaking the fourth wall.

I also feel like the hex maniac doesn't quite stand out enough from the rest of the noise, also. You have the right idea by rendering her shading and lighting more than the pokemon (I especially like how the zubats have no outlines), but I feel like you could do a bit more with value and colors to make her pop. Maybe have the background be darker and more indigo-hued with less contrast, and then have Hex maniac be a brighter violet or purple.

Overall, I like this piece, and I'd like to see where you go next!
